Mining News: Miners chase projects in Canada’s ArcticDiamond producers battle effects of strong Canadian dollar, while handful of others advance various properties toward development Rose Ragsdale For Mining News
Mining exploration appears to be hotter than ever this season in the Northwest Territories and Nunavut, but the Canadian Arctic region’s few producers are getting hammered by the strong Canadian dollar.
